#b07c02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b07c02 is composed of 69% red, 48.6%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 29.5% magenta, 98.9%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 42.1 degrees, a saturation of 97.8% and a lightness of 34.9%. #b07c02 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ff804 with #610000. Closest websafe color is: #996600.

● #b07c02 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#b07c02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b07c02 has RGB values of R:176, G:124,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.3, Y:0.99,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11566082.

Shades and Tints of #b07c02
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#fff9ed is the lightest one.

Tones of #b07c02
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5e5b54 is the less saturated color, while #b07c02 is the most saturated one.
